We kept to our family traditions during the day, having Christmas lunch at 1pm then watching the Queens speech then opening our presents one by one. Our mum was very impressed when we spoke to her later!

Yes you read correctly that we don't open our presents until after 3pm. A lot of people are shocked/horrified that we have to wait so long for our presents but in our household it is always how it has been done so we don't find it unusual at all.

As children Christmas morning was always taken up by opening our stockings and playing with the contents. Christmas lunch was usually ready soon after, and by the time this was finished we all watched the queens speech, the longest 10 mins ever before we finally got our big presents!
We also had a present kept for Boxing day too!

The time in-between was usually taken up by playing games, watching TV. today at my sisters it was a large version of Jenga.
